Namibia: Bird Flu Continues to Wipe Out Penguins
HIGHLY pathogenic avian influenza continues to wipe out penguins at the Halifax Island beach near Lüderitz.
Publication Date:
01/03/2019
HIGHLY pathogenic avian influenza continues to wipe out penguins at the Halifax Island beach near Lüderitz.